Graphic Packaging Holding Company (NYSE:GPK – Get Free Report) has earned an average rating of “Reduce” from the twelve analysts that are presently covering the firm, Marketbeat reports.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ating and nine have assigned a hold rating to the company. The average 12 month target price among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$11.1444.
A number of research firms have recently commented on GPK. Raymond James Financial cut Graphic Packaging from a “market perform” rating to an “underperform” rating in a report on Tuesday, April 21st. Wells Fargo & Company raised their price objective on Graphic Packaging from $9.00 to $10.00 and gave the company an “underweight” rating in a research note on Wednesday, August 5th. Zacks Research upgraded Graphic Packaging from a “strong s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Monday, June 1st. Bank of America initiated coverage on Graphic Packaging in a research note on Tuesday, July 14th. They set a “neutral” rating and a $12.00 target price for the company. Finally, Citigroup increased their target price on shares of Graphic Packaging from $10.00 to $11.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a report on Thursday, May 7th.

Graphic Packaging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E:GPK opened at $11.40 on Monday. The company’s 50 day simple moving average is $10.94 and its 200 day simple moving average is $10.87. The stock has a market capitalization of $3.38 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 17.27 and a beta of 0.66.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.58, a current ratio of 1.38 and a quick ratio of 0.60. Graphic Packaging has a 1 year low of $8.78 and a 1 year high of $23.47.
Graphic Packaging (NYSE:GPK –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 4th. The industrial products company reported $0.14 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.12 by $0.02. Graphic Packaging had a net margin of 2.25% and a return on equity of 9.95%. The business had revenue of $2.19 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.18 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.42 earnings per share. The company’s revenue was down .7% on a year-over-year basis. Graphic Packaging has set its FY 2026 guidance at 0.650-0.900 E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Graphic Packaging will post 0.68 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Graphic Packaging Announces Dividend
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, October 6th. Investors of record on Tuesday, September 15th will be given a dividend of $0.11 per share. This represents a $0.44 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.9%.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, September 15th. Graphic Packaging’s dividend payout ratio is currently 66.67%.
Graphic Packaging Company Profile
Graphic Packaging Holding Company is a leading provider of sustainable paperboard packaging solutions, offering a broad portfolio of products designed for food, beverage and other consumer goods markets. The company specializes in the manufacture of containerboard, folding cartons and engineered fill materials, as well as beverage packaging systems including paperboard cups, carriers and related components.
Through a network of manufacturing facilities across North America, Europe and Latin America, Graphic Packaging serves a diverse customer base that includes major consumer packaged goods companies, quick-service restaurants and retail chains.
